Let's Play Japan: Wheel Of Zombie
We thank Let's Play Japan again for another light-hearted fun gameplay video. This dynamic duo knows just how to make us laugh here at...
Let's Play Japan: ZOMBIES hate MINERAL WATER?
Welcome, Let's Play Japan to our Final Fortress Team. They have given us our first review from Japan. It is light-hearted and full of...